Dev Perfects
40 subscribers
9.23K photos
1.26K videos
468 files
13K links
بخوام خیلی خلاصه بگم
این کانال میاد مطالب کانالای خفن تو حوزه تکنولوژی و برنامه نویسی رو جمع میکنه

پست پین رو بخونید
https://t.iss.one/dev_perfects/455


ارتباط:
https://t.iss.one/HidenChat_Bot?start=936082426
Download Telegram
Forwarded from Linuxor ?
لیت کد یکی از بزرگ ترین سایتای تمرین الگوریتم و برنامه نویسیه، اینجا جواب بیش از هزار تا از معروف ترین مسائلش رو گذاشته، اگه هیچ انگیزه ای برای درگیری با مسائل لیت کد ندارین چندا از این جوابارو ببینید بعد خودتون حلش کنید یه انگیزه خوب برای شروعه

github.com/haoel/leetcode

@Linuxor
Forwarded from Reza Jafari
یکی دیگه از بچه‌هایی که دوره منتورینگ شرکت کرده بود تونست طی ۸ ماه با زحمات و تلاش خودش از صفر به نقطه‌ای برسه که کار بگیره.🥳🥳🥳

@reza_jafari_ai
Forwarded from linuxtnt(linux tips and tricks) (hosein seilany https://seilany.ir/)
سلام دوستان عزیز

نسخه چاپی کتاب مرجع «۱۰۰۱ دستور لینوکس» به اتمام رسید.

نسخه pdf کتاب بر روی سایت اکادمی موجود است.

جزئیات کتاب در:
https://learninghive.ir
Forwarded from محتوای آزاد سهراب (Sohrab)
این بنده خدا هم کرنلش رو آپدیت کردم به آخرین چیزی که از پست‌مارکت هست :))


یک میکروفون و دوربین تلفات دادیم

@SohrabContents
Forwarded from محتوای آزاد سهراب (Sohrab)
Forwarded from محتوای آزاد سهراب (Sohrab)
Forwarded from محتوای آزاد سهراب (Sohrab)
Forwarded from 🎄 یک برنامه نویس تنبل (Lazy 🌱)
🔶 لیبرالیسم وعده آزادی بدون مسئولیت، حقوق بدون قدرت، و برابری بدون پیامد را داد. توهمی را فروخت که گویا کلماتی روی کاغذ مانند قانون اساسی، منشور حقوق و بیانیه‌ها ... می‌توانند انسان‌ها را محکم‌تر از خود دولت مقید کنند. اما وقتی قدرتی برای دفاع از آن‌ها نباشد، این کلمات فرو می‌ریزند.

دموکراسی ‌ای که در آن شهروندان خلع سلاح شده‌اند، چیزی جز یک نمایش نیست. حقوق روی کاغذ، انتخابات، و تشریفات، همه حرکاتی پوچ ‌اند در حالی که قدرت واقعی در دست دولتی است که اسلحه را در اختیار دارد.

طنز تلخ ماجرا این است که کشورهایی که دموکراسی ندارند، صادق‌ ترند. دولت در آنجا می‌پذیرد که حاکم است، می‌پذیرد که قدرت در دست اوست و اغلب هم وظیفه ‌اش را انجام می‌دهد: امنیت مردم را تأمین می‌کند و نظم را برقرار می‌سازد. در آنجا معامله روشن است و واقعیت دارد.

اما دموکراسی ‌های لیبرال وانمود می‌کنند که متفاوت‌اند. به شما می‌گویند که شما حکومت می‌کنید، شما آزادید، در حالی که همان چیزی را از شما می‌گیرند که آزادی را واقعی می‌کند: ابزار مقاومت. بریتانیا روشن‌ترین نمونه است. انتخابات و حقوق کاغذی را به نمایش می‌گذارد، اما شهروندانش را خلع سلاح می‌کند و خشونت را در انحصار خود نگه می‌دارد. سپس حتی در انجام ساده‌ترین وظیفه ‌اش یعنی حفاظت از مردم ناکام می‌ماند.

این مرگ لیبرالیسم است. نه تنها از آزادی محافظت نمی‌کند، بلکه آن را تضعیف می‌کند. نه تنها شهروند را توانمند نمی‌سازد، بلکه او را رام می‌کند.

دموکراسی لیبرال در عمل، وابستگی ‌ای است که با نقاب آزادی عرضه می‌شود؛ یک نمایش صحنه‌ای که مردم را آرام نگه می‌دارد، در حالی که دولت از مسئولیت شانه خالی می‌کند و چنگال خود را محکم‌تر می‌سازد. لیبرالیسم به آزمایشی شکست ‌خورده بدل شده است: ایدئولوژی که وعده حکومت مردمی داد، اما زوال مدیریت ‌شده تحویل داد؛ زبانی از آزادی سخن گفت، اما مردمانش را ضعیف ‌تر، بی‌دفاع ‌تر، و ناتوان ‌تر در حفاظت از همان حقوقی کرد که به آن‌ها جا زده بود, جاودانه ‌اند.

نویسنده : ایان مایلز چیُنگ (Ian Miles Cheong) از مالزی

#منهای_برنامه_نویسی

@TheRaymondDev
Forwarded from Gopher Academy
🔵 عنوان مقاله
Understanding Go Error Types: Pointer vs. Value

🟢 خلاصه مقاله:
تفاوت میان تعریف خطا با گیرنده مقداری و اشاره‌گری در Go می‌تواند به خطاهای پنهان منجر شود. اگر متد Error را با گیرنده مقداری تعریف کنید، هر دو T و *T اینترفیس error را پیاده‌سازی می‌کنند؛ اما با گیرنده اشاره‌گری فقط *T این کار را می‌کند. پیامدها: امکان ایجاد اینترفیس error غیرnil که حاوی اشاره‌گر nil است و بررسی err != nil را گمراه می‌کند، و شکست بی‌سروصدای errors.Is/As در صورت عدم تطابق نوع مقداری/اشاره‌گری. راهکارها: برای انواع کوچک و تغییرناپذیر از گیرنده مقداری استفاده کنید و فقط در صورت نیاز واقعی از گیرنده اشاره‌گری بهره ببرید؛ سازگاری در ساخت و بازگرداندن خطاها را رعایت کنید؛ با assertion کامپایلی اطمینان بگیرید نوع شما error را پیاده‌سازی می‌کند و تست رفتار nil را اضافه کنید.

🟣لینک مقاله:
https://golangweekly.com/link/173124/web


👑 @gopher_academy
Forwarded from Geek Alerts
مرورگر کروم قرار نیست فروخته بشه و یه قاضی فدرال تو آمریکا رای داده که نیازی به این نیست، کلا سخت‌گیری وزارت دادگستری رو زیر سوال برده و میگه با اومدن این همه هوش‌مصنوعی انحصار گوگل داره خود به خود از بین میره و نیازی به جدا کردن سرویس‌های گوگل ازش نیست.

از طرفی گفتن گوگل میتونه همچنان پول بده به مرورگرها برای اینکه موتور جستجوی پیش‌فرض بشه اما نمیتونه قرارداد انحصاری ببنده، همچنین گوگل باید بخشی از دیتاهای خودش رو به صورت عمومی منتشر کنه تا رقباش هم بتونن از اون دیتاها برای موتور جستجوی خودشون استفاده کنن.

دادگاه یه کمیته نظارت برای شش سال هم درسته کرده تا روی روند فعالیت‌های گوگل و اجرای این رای‌ها نظارت داشته باشن، بازار سهام هم واکنشش به خاطر عدم سختگیری دادگاه مثبت بود و سهام گوگل ۳ درصد رشد رو تجربه کرد. [L]

🤓 @geekalerts
Please open Telegram to view this post
VIEW IN TELEGRAM
Forwarded from Linuxor ?
کی چت جی پی تی رو ناراحت کرده؟ چت هاشو دوطرفه پاک کرده!

@Linuxor
Forwarded from 🎄 یک برنامه نویس تنبل (Lazy 🌱)
🔶 مهندسان نرم‌افزار عزیز،

سعی کنید پیچیدگی کدهای خود را کاهش دهید.
به نفر بعدی رحم کنید، شما همیشه آنجا نخواهید بود.

این یک توصیه بسیار مهم در مهندسی نرم‌افزار و توسعه پایدار است. کدی که امروز می‌نویسید، ممکن است فردا توسط شخص دیگری نگهداری شود. اگر پیچیده و بی ‌مستند باشد، نه تنها روند توسعه کند می‌شود بلکه هزینه نگهداری، اشکال‌ زدایی و توسعه‌های آینده را هم بالا می‌برد.

#توییت

@TheRaymondDev
بنده خدا نمیدونه ویدیو‌های من با قرص خواب‌آور فرقی نداره
😂